So there are some more things for you to do in Beryl before you head to the Lapis Ward.

In the Beryl Mansion, the place where you can find the dead police officer, A Gothitelle will appear, and ask you to clean the place up.

Basically just run around and spam the "c" button. When the whole place is spotless, Gothitelle will give you a soul candle. You can also take one of the Gothita with you.

Recieving the Soul Candle will activate another event in Beryl. If you go to the graveyard at night, check a pumpkin and a pumpkaboo will appear. The candle is one-time use.

If you saved all the policemen and you stop at the Police Station, you can get a growlithe if you talk to the mustache guy.

North, you'll find an alleyway. This is the Team Magma hideout.

Pokemon Reborn Guide [2.0] (6)

In Reborn you have the choice between "Magma and Aqua Gangs". They're not the actual evil teams, but a two rival gangs that follow their main principles. The gang that you choose will affect the pokemon you can get later on.

If you join Magma, you'll receive a Buizel, and eventually a Houndour.

If you join Aqua, you'll receive a Ponyta, and eventually a Carvahna.

If you continue left down that street, you'll find two houses with very informational men giving you the rundown of the Reborn region.

There's also a nightclub. At night, you can find this guy hanging around.

Pokemon Reborn Guide [2.0] (12)

He'll introduce himself as Arc'. He tells you that you need to be an Ace Member to get in. The only way you'll be considered to be an Ace Member is if you beat the Reborn League, so there's not much for you to do here now.

This house holds the Move Deleter.

The Lapis Ward

The Lapis Ward is the richest in the Reborn Region, yet for some reason has the most gang activity.

In this house you can buy a bike for $100,000,000. Considering that you can eventually access a free bicycle... I wouldn't recommend this purchase...

If you're like me, and you want to put it off as long as possible, you can visit the Sweet Scent Flower Shop.

Pokemon Reborn Guide [2.0] (28)

There you can get a Wailmer Pail, as well as buy some flower-y items. I highly recommend you buy the Floral Charm, as it will help you in an event later on in the game. You can find Budew's trainer as well, as she'll tell you to keep the pokemon (as you probably already did).

There's also another puzzle for you to complete. When you complete it, you'll get a Spritzee. Here is the solution:

If you talk to the leader of you respective Aqua/Magma gang, they'll tell you that they're planning something tonight, and to meet them at 4th and Hydrangea. You can find them, at night, in this house:

Pokemon Reborn Guide [2.0] (31)

Talk to your leader, and he'll tell you that the opposite gang is trying to steal a pokemon from Mrs. Craudburry. You're supposed to interfere, and steal the pokemon yourself.

Mrs. Craudburry lives in this house:

Pokemon Reborn Guide [2.0] (32)

Heading in, you'll have to battle your way through some Grunts form the opposite gang to reach the back of the house. You can find a water or fire stone on a desk next to the pokemon you're supposed to steal. If you feel bad about this, listen to me. Mrs. Craudburry is not as innocent an old lady as she might seem. She doesn't deserve this pokemon, and you'll learn about it later in the game.

If you joined Magma: Buizel Pokemon Reborn Guide [2.0] (33)level 25 / water gun, pursuit, swift, aqua jet

If you joined Aqua: PonytaPokemon Reborn Guide [2.0] (34) level 25 / fire spin, flame charge, stomp, flame wheel

The gangs will leave. If you visit yours, they'll tell you to keep the pokemon.

In the morning, Craudburry will be talking to a police officer. She'll accuse you of the crime you committed, but the officer won't believe her, as you're the one who saved his life. When you leave, he'll give you a bike voucher. You can now get a bike at the bike shop.

So anyways, head down the first ladder you see. After you descend that, you'll find yourself in a large, cavernous room. It's a one way road for you, since most directions are blocked off by rocks [you can access these areas when you get Rock Smash]. Head south.

So now you'll be in another large, Meteor Falls-esque room. You can continue by hopping down ledges. There are four routes for you to take.

If you take the far left route, you can head up a ladder. This is pretty useless, as it will only take you up to where you started.

The second to left route will twist left, and let you go up a divided staircase.

Over here you can find TM63 Embargo.

Pokemon Reborn Guide [2.0] (50)

If you talk to this guy, you can get TM94 Rock Smash. Unfortunately, you cannot use it until you obtain the Lapis Gym Badge.

Pokemon Reborn Guide [2.0] (51)

The far right route will lead you on another winding upwards route.

You can find a Focus Sash on this rock.

Pokemon Reborn Guide [2.0] (52)

You can find another Ability Capsule here.

Pokemon Reborn Guide [2.0] (53)

At the end of the route you'll find yourself back where you started.

So, as you've probably guessed by now, the correct route for you to take is the second to right path. Heading down the ladder, you'll find yourself on a long staircase [so many staircases in this part of the game...]. Descend it, and heal your pokemon with a Light Shard, if you wish.

You'll find a dark haired man standing in front of a dull gray door, the same man you met in the abandoned factory way back in Peridot. He tells you that behind the gate is "the very core of the Reborn Region," which he simply explains as some vast power. He further explains that Reborn was built on four key powers:

Ruby, the seal of pain

Sapphire, the seal of love

Emerald, the seal of faith

Amethyst, the seal of beyond

These four overarching themes of pain, faith, love, and beyond will come up again and again throughout the storyline. You've already learned a little about Ruby, remember that Ruby Ring of Corey's? The seal of pain...

He goes on to say that each one is a key that unlocks Reborn's true power. It seems that this man's goal is to get rid of Reborn City by restoring it to its previous form. He tells you that he'll let your friend go free. He leaves.

Actual Gym 3: Shelly

This gym's puzzle is actual hell. You can try to figure it out on your own, but I usually use this fantastic video.

Shelly specializes in bug type pokemon, and battles on a Forest field, the same one you had against PULSE!Tangrowth. Its effects are here. A ton of her pokemon have huge power dups because of this field, so I'd highly recommend trying to break it. A pokemon with flame burst would be optimal.

NOTE: this gym is a double battle.

If you need to grind, I'd recommend beneath the Grand Stairway, or the alleyways, if you want.

A flying type with air cutter will destroy her.

So her Yanmega is pretty obnoxious. You can't battle it with a flying or fire type because it knows ancient power, and it has speed boost. Get rid of that thing ASAP. It might be a good idea to try and paralyze it.

Also watch out if you're planning on beating her with a fire type, she has countless counters to them.

After you defeat her, you recieve the Cocoon badge, so pokemon up to level 40 will obey you now, and you can use rock smash outside of battle. She'll also give you TM76 Struggle Bug.
